Trickey Pond is one of the cleanest lakes in Maine. It has great fishing, swimming and boating (no jet skis allowed) and is about 60 feet deep with over 300 Acres. The house is only about 3 miles from the village of Naples (and the southern end of Long Lake) for dining, shopping and other activities. Portland is only 45 minutes away for fine restaurants, shopping and the ocean.
